wincc的按鈕問題
劉玉蓉
發(fā)布于2014-11-25 17:49
3
0
標(biāo)簽:
wincc兩個(gè)按鈕點(diǎn)其中一個(gè)時(shí)為1另一個(gè)為零,請(qǐng)問有什么比較簡單的方法嗎?
佳答案
還可以用C語言寫。
假如你的變量是 k
按鈕1的代碼為:屬性 事件 鼠標(biāo)動(dòng)作:C動(dòng)作
代碼:Settagbit("k",1);
按鈕2的代碼為: 屬性 事件 鼠標(biāo)動(dòng)作:C動(dòng)作
代碼:Settagbit("k",0);
簡便的方法就是1樓說的直接連接,無需寫程序,只要快速組態(tài)變量以及動(dòng)作屬性。因?yàn)槟阋獙?shí)現(xiàn)的要求比較少,如果你不僅僅要置1或者置0的話,比如要改變按鈕名稱、按鈕要附上顏色等等,就要用到腳本代碼了,在C語言或者VB中都是通過掃描指令來實(shí)現(xiàn)某種功能,故應(yīng)用很靈活方便,建議有時(shí)間學(xué)習(xí)學(xué)習(xí)C語言,因?yàn)橛泻芏嗌衔粰C(jī)組態(tài)都是用到C語言的。